What happens while it is decided

The process from here

This application is with Conwy for determination. The council publicises it, consults neighbours and technical bodies where required, and weighs the responses against local and national planning policy.

The statutory target is eight weeks for most applications and thirteen for major development, though extensions of time are common. Comments carry most weight while the case is undecided, so check the council portal for the deadline if you want to respond.

About heritage and listed buildings applications

How this application type works

Heritage applications concern listed buildings and conservation areas. Listed building consent is needed for works, inside or out, that affect the special interest of a listed building, and carrying out such works without consent is a criminal offence. The council weighs harm to the heritage asset against any public benefit of the proposal.
